Overview of AS/NZS 1802 Type 240 Cable

The AS/NZS 1802 Type 240 1.1-11 kV Composite Screened Cable is a heavy-duty flexible mining and industrial power cable specifically engineered for demanding mobile and fixed equipment applications in underground mines, tunnelling operations, pump stations, and mineral processing environments.

Designed in accordance with the Australian and New Zealand mining cable standard AS/NZS 1802, Type 240 cable combines:

  • Three screened power conductors

  • One central pilot conductor

  • Three auxiliary pilot cores

  • Composite earth screen

  • Heavy-duty PCP sheath

This construction provides excellent electrical safety, mechanical durability, flame retardancy, and operational reliability in harsh mining conditions.

The cable is widely used as:

  • Feeder cable between transformer and gate-end box

  • Continuous miner trailing cable

  • Pump feeder cable

  • Underground mining distribution cable

  • Mobile mining equipment power cable

Its three separate pilot conductors allow long cable runs without compromising pilot control protection system resistance limitations, making it particularly suitable for large underground mining networks.

Construction Details of AS/NZS 1802 Type 240 Cable

Conductor

  • Material: Tinned copper

  • Configuration: Three power cores plus central pilot

  • Flexible stranded construction for mining applications

Tinned copper conductors improve corrosion resistance in humid underground environments.


Conductor Separator Tape

1.1/1.1 kV Versions

  • Polyester separator tape

3.3 kV and Above

  • Semiconductive separator tape

The semiconductive tape helps control electrical stress in medium-voltage applications.


Insulation

  • Material: EPR (R-EP-90)

  • Maximum operating temperature: +90°C

EPR insulation provides:

  • Excellent dielectric performance

  • High thermal stability

  • Superior flexibility

  • Good moisture resistance


Insulation Tape and Screening

1.1/1.1 kV

  • Proofed textile insulation tape

3.3 kV and Above

  • Semiconductive insulation screen

The screened construction improves electrical field control and operational safety in medium-voltage systems.


Composite Screen (Earth)

The composite screen consists of:

  • Tinned annealed copper wires

  • Polyester yarn

Benefits include:

  • Effective grounding

  • Enhanced fault current handling

  • Mechanical reinforcement

  • Improved cable reliability


Pilot Conductors

Three separate pilot conductors are installed in the interstitial cavities.

Construction includes:

  • Elastomer covering

  • Proofed taped design

The pilot system supports:

  • Monitoring circuits

  • Earth continuity systems

  • Protection relay functions

  • Long-distance control systems


Outer Sheath

  • Material: Heavy-duty HD-85-PCP

  • Reinforced sheath option available upon request

The PCP sheath delivers exceptional resistance to:

  • Abrasion

  • Cuts and tearing

  • Mining chemicals

  • Water ingress

  • UV exposure
